When you need some quick and fun cupcakes to serve, give these guys a buzz!
After you’ve iced your cupcakes, decorating the bees is a breeze-with a rosette body and fun candy features.

Tools:
Standard muffin pan
Cooling Grid
Standard White Baking Cups
Tips: 1, 7, 4B
Spatula
Quick Ease Roller 1907-1202
Disposable Decorating Bags
Large Coupler
Waxed paper
Scissors
Ingredients:
Food coloring: Lemon Yellow, Leaf Green, Violet, Black
Buttercream icing medium consistency
Mini round candies
Black shoestring licorice
candy corn
small candy eyes
spice drops
granulated sugar
Your favorite cupcake recipe
Makes: Each cupcake serves 1.
 

instructions
Step 1
Bake cupcakes in White Standard Baking Cups and cool completely on Cooling Grid.
Step 2
Prepare Buttercream Icing recipe. Reserve half of the icing. Tint remaining half of icing with a small amount of Lemon Yellow Icing Color, a small amount of Violet Icing Color, a small amount of Leaf Green Icing Color and a small amount of Black Icing Color.
Step 3
Ice cupcakes smooth with white buttercream icing using Spatula.
Step 4
On a countertop or other surface covered with waxed paper, roll out spice drops. Cut into wing shapes with scissors.
Step 5
Starting in the rear, pipe rosette body using Multi-Opening Tip 4B. Pipe rosette body sections in yellow, green, yellow, violet and yellow, making each new color section slightly larger than the previous one. Pipe rosette head in yellow using Multi-Opening Tip 4B.
Step 6
Cut a short piece of black shoestring licorice for each antenna and mouth. Attach a mini round candy to each antenna with a dot of white icing, using Round Tip 1. Insert antennae, candy corn stinger and spice drop wings in bee body. Position mini round candy nose and licorice mouth.
